Exciting announcement

May 18th, 2009

Freakwitch will be opening for the Heroes of Woodstock show at The Barnyard in Livermore, Maine on August 9th, sometime in the early afternoon. Headlining this show are original acts from the original Woodstock show 40 years ago: Jefferson Starship, Canned Heat, Big Brother and The Holding Company, Ten Years After, Country Joe McDonald and Grateful Dead’s Tom Constanten. Freakwitch and two other local bands will be opening.

We are definitely looking forward to playing this show, as it will mean playing for a lot of people who may not have heard us before. Cool!

Nine Muses demo/album preview

May 14th, 2009

We decided to take some excerpts from the basic tracks from the album, and put them into a nine-minute montage to serve as both a demo as well as a preview of the album. You can get the mp3 file here, or check out our MySpace page to hear it.

These are the “basic tracks” of the album, in other words these recordings are the 5 of us playing live, with no overdubs or studio trickery of any kind. Of course, the final album will have plenty of overdubs (mostly guitars and vocals), and will sound a bit different, but we feel these relatively stripped-down files do a good job of capturing the energy of the 5 of us playing music.

The song excerpts are from Seems Like, Tip Of My Tongue, Too Bad For You, Breathe, Cackle, Sway, Long Way To Go, Make It Through, and Unglued.

Enjoy!

Basic Tracks…. done!

February 23rd, 2009

Freakwitch in Wymanspace

We had a GREAT weekend at Jon Wyman’s studio. In this shot, I was standing in the live room, and took this shot, you can see the back of Jon’s head, and Todd, Alfred, Matthew, and Yo as we listen back to some of the takes. And if you really look, you can see my reflection as I took this picture, right in front of the diffusors on Jon’s back wall.

After a weekend of chill, vibey, and productive work, all the basic tracks (meaning drums and bass) are finished for the new album. They sound great, these are easily the best basic tracks I’ve ever had to work with for Freakwitch. This is due to several factors…. Alfred’s drumming, Jon’s engineering chops, a great kit, a great room…. and most importantly, a well-rehearsed band of skillful people doing their thing…. there were very few edits required, only a handful, which were usually just splicing together different takes. This is refreshing in this age of grid-editing, drumagog, beat detecting, and drum samples; great drum tracks that don’t involve me programming fake drums! What a concept.

Next step…. JWL’s guitars. Stay tuned.
